Cartes de combattants
The fighter card was created by the law of December 19th, 1926 and ensures rights to the owner, like a pension and tax benefits.The car dis establish on demand and is delivered by the national Department of Veterans Affairs (l'Office National des Anciens Combattants (ONAC)). This office must ensure that the person has fought at least 3 consecutive month or not. Those documents give precious information for the researches: the last and first name, date and place of birth, and home address. Those cards have another interest, the picture of the fighter and his signature!The records of Veterans cards over 90 years can be destroyed by the ONAC but some documents are given to the Departmental Archives like in the Hautes-Alpes. The preserved and digitalized cards are those return by their holder during the thirties in exchange for a new card.
